Our company went to the studio sleeper in the T660, and it's massive inside. storage is not really big, but it is spacious for the body. I've never been in another brand so that is as far as I'll go on that. It appears a quite a few companies are getting these sleepers on the new trucks.

If this is important to you as a choice I would go to a few truck dealers and look at trucks.
Find one you like, then find a company with that make of truck.
Keep in mind you won't get the nicest truck starting out with any company.
